Identifying the areas for integration

If you're wondering where to begin integrating AI into your business, look no further. Start by identifying sluggish business processes that could benefit from AI, such as customer service. Modern chatbots, continually learning and improving, can swiftly respond to customer inquiries, maintain engagement and even handle order processing. AI and automation can also revolutionize your supply chain and inventory management. They enable you to predict and preempt disruptions.

Real-world applications

The proof of real-world applications of AI and BPA is evident in numerous businesses that have embraced these technologies and are now enjoying the benefits. Amazon, a titan of efficiency, employs AI and BPA to enhance everything from customer recommendations to delivery routes, functioning like a well-oiled machine.

Similarly, Netflix, the empire of binge-watching, utilizes AI to seemingly predict your viewing preferences, offering a personalized user experience. These examples demonstrate the transformative power of AI and BPA in the business landscape.

Legal and ethical considerations

Navigating the legal and ethical landscape of AI and BPA is akin to staying on the straight and narrow, where exercising great power demands great responsibility. It's crucial not to throw caution to the wind but consider the implications of data privacy.

Transparency with customers about their data usage is paramount in this digital age. Furthermore, the game of AI must be played by the rules, ensuring fairness and avoiding bias. It's essential to scrutinize AI algorithms to prevent discrimination and maintain a fair and unbiased digital environment.
